Day 1: Exploring the Royal Heritage
Morning: Arrival and Amber Fort
Your tour kicks off with a warm welcome in Jaipur. After a quick freshening up, head straight to the magnificent Amber Fort, located just 11 km from the city center. This UNESCO World Heritage Site, built with red sandstone and marble, is a fine example of Rajput architecture. Don’t miss the elephant ride up to the fort gate or the panoramic views of Maota Lake from the fort’s ramparts.
Afternoon: Jal Mahal & City Palace
On your way back, stop at the scenic Jal Mahal – the Water Palace floating in the middle of Man Sagar Lake. Though entry inside isn’t allowed, the view from the banks is breathtaking and perfect for photos. Then move on to the City Palace, an architectural marvel that still houses the royal family of Jaipur. The museum showcases royal costumes, weapons, and artifacts that give a glimpse into Jaipur’s regal past.
Evening: Jantar Mantar & Hawa Mahal
Visit the Jantar Mantar, an ancient astronomical observatory and another UNESCO site. Then walk to the nearby Hawa Mahal or the “Palace of Winds.” Its unique façade with 953 small windows was designed for royal women to observe city life without being seen.
Wrap up the evening by strolling through the vibrant Johari Bazaar or Bapu Bazaar, where you can shop for traditional Rajasthani jewelry, textiles, and handicrafts.
Day 2: Culture, Crafts & Cuisine
Morning: Albert Hall Museum & Birla Temple
Begin your day with a visit to the Albert Hall Museum, the oldest museum in Rajasthan, showcasing artifacts from across India. Then proceed to the white marble Birla Temple, a serene place dedicated to Lord Vishnu and Goddess Lakshmi.
Afternoon: Nahargarh Fort
After lunch, head to the Nahargarh Fort, perched on the Aravalli hills. This fort offers one of the best panoramic views of Jaipur. It’s a great spot for photography and a peaceful retreat away from the city’s hustle.
Evening: Cultural Dinner & Departure
Conclude your Jaipur adventure with a cultural evening at Chokhi Dhani, a traditional Rajasthani village-themed resort. Enjoy folk music, dance performances, camel rides, and an authentic Rajasthani thali dinner. It’s a fitting farewell to the city’s hospitality and charm.
